技术文摘
Tomcat 如何处理搜索引擎爬虫请求
Tomcat 如何处理搜索引擎爬虫请求
在当今数字化的世界中,搜索引擎爬虫对于网站的可见性和流量至关重要。Tomcat 作为一款广泛使用的 Web 服务器,其处理搜索引擎爬虫请求的方式对于网站的优化和性能有着重要影响。
Tomcat 通过识别搜索引擎爬虫的用户代理字符串来辨别请求是否来自爬虫。用户代理字符串包含了有关发出请求的客户端的信息,例如浏览器类型、操作系统等。搜索引擎爬虫通常具有特定的用户代理标识,Tomcat 可以根据这些标识来区分普通用户请求和爬虫请求。
当 Tomcat 确认请求来自搜索引擎爬虫时,会对其进行特殊的处理。一方面,Tomcat 会优化资源分配,以确保爬虫能够快速获取所需的页面内容。这可能包括优先处理爬虫请求,或者为爬虫分配更多的服务器资源,以加快响应速度。
另一方面,Tomcat 会处理与爬虫相关的缓存策略。对于经常被爬虫访问的静态资源,Tomcat 可以设置合适的缓存头信息,以便爬虫在后续请求中能够直接从缓存中获取,减少服务器的负载和响应时间。
Tomcat 还需要确保向搜索引擎爬虫提供准确和有价值的信息。这包括正确设置页面的标题、描述、关键词等元数据,以及确保页面的结构和内容易于爬虫理解和索引。
为了更好地处理搜索引擎爬虫请求,管理员还可以对 Tomcat 进行相关的配置优化。例如,调整连接超时时间、设置最大并发连接数等,以适应爬虫的访问模式和频率。
要注意监控 Tomcat 处理爬虫请求的性能和日志。通过分析日志,可以了解爬虫的访问行为和趋势,发现可能存在的问题,并及时进行调整和优化。
Tomcat 对搜索引擎爬虫请求的有效处理是提升网站在搜索引擎中排名和可见性的关键因素之一。通过合理的配置、优化资源分配和提供准确的信息,能够让搜索引擎爬虫更高效地抓取网站内容,从而为网站带来更多的流量和曝光机会。
TAGS: Tomcat 配置 Tomcat 处理机制 搜索引擎爬虫 爬虫请求分析
- Vue 与网易云 API 打造个性化歌单推荐系统的方法
- Vue项目中用keep-alive实现页面保存功能的方法
- Vue 与 Excel 实现表格数据多条件筛选的方法
- Vue 与 Excel 实现数据自动排序及导出的方法
- Vue 与 Element-UI 打造响应式网页界面的方法
- Vue项目中使用HTMLDocx生成可下载Word文档的方法
- Vue 与 HTMLDocx:在线编辑与导出文档最佳实践指南
- Vue 与 ECharts4Taro3 进阶:实现动态数据更新实时图表的方法
- Vue 与 Element-UI 实现弹窗提示功能的方法
- Vue 与 Axios 协同,优化前端数据请求处理流程
- Vue与ECharts4Taro3中复杂数据可视化的数据过滤及筛选实现方法
- Vue 中利用路由实现页面间数据传递与状态管理的方法
- Vue 中借助 keep-alive 提高前端开发效率的方法
- Vue 实现 HTML 到 HTMLDocx 转换:快速文档生成策略
- Vue中如何利用路由实现页面跳转